请保证你的 vue-cli 的版本在 4.5.13 以上

来源:2-2 使用 vue-cli 创建项目

静秋叶

2022-10-30

老师,升级这个是不是为了后面的这样的写法?
课程已经基本看完了,老师你讲的非常好,不过最近想做一个公众号的项目,考虑着移动端项目要不用vant,看了下官方demo,用的类似下面的写法:
setup() {
const username = ref(’’);
const password = ref(’’);
const onSubmit = (values) => {
console.log(‘submit’, values);
};

return {
username,
password,
onSubmit,
};
}

突然脑子有点乱!!!有点蒙,是不是4.5.x之前的是setup(){}的写法,大于等于4.5.13是的写法,求老师解惑

写回答

1回答

Sunday

2022-10-31

你好

这种 setup 函数的形式是 vue 3.0 刚推出时提出的 composition API 的形式,只不过后来发现 setup 函数并不好用,所以才提出了新的 script setup 的语法糖形式。 

这个只与 vue 的版本有关(vue 3.2 之后正式发布的 script setup),与其他的依赖版本无关。

1
0

基于Vue3新标准,打造后台综合解决方案

基于Vue3重写Vue-element-admin,打造后台前端综合解决方案

1942 学习 · 1688 问题

查看课程